How were women affected by the ideas of the enlightenment ?

History
1 answer:
hichkok12 [17]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

The Enlightenment era was often viewed as the founder of individualism and rationality. Women at that time often challenge those ideas and started questioning their roles in society. Out of the salons, women were able to obtain knowledge and gain literary support.

How did the Constitution address the problem under the Articles of Confederation that Congress had no power to ensure were follo
Soloha48 [4]

Answer: The U.S. Constitution addressed this problem by creating an executive branch to enforce laws made by the U.S. Congress.
